Output 29542ad8615661ea135022a81e13764eb30b10a36446d4111fb015a41fb564e3:1

value
574112
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1aae47f952b6d2415ff898e476f13f45c3963aa3 OP_EQUALVERIFY OP_CHECKSIG
address
13S5MFjdaEyhrqY9uiFKy8EjDfEQuaQSqi
transaction
29542ad8615661ea135022a81e13764eb30b10a36446d4111fb015a41fb564e3
confirmations
350903
spent
true